Shelsley Walsh Vintage Meeting, Sunday 4 July 2010

30 Jun



This Sunday sees the celebrated Vintage meeting in association with the Vintage Sports-Car Club. The entry at the 105 year old hill features some of the most historic cars to be seen at any motor sport meeting anywhere in the world.

The oldest car on view will be the 1907 Berliet of John Dennis. This car has been fitted with the Curtiss engine from a first World War aeroplane. The honour of having the largest engine falls to the Delage of Anthony Howat which is powered by a 27 litre Hispano Suiza aeroplane engine.

Not only is there great competition on the track, but on vintage day many spectators arrive in cars as historic as those competing and many of these will be worth inspecting.

Admission prices -  Sunday £18 per person

Includes parking, transfer to paddock, and seated trackside enclosures.

Accompanied children under 16
FREE

Shelsley Walsh is AA signposted approximately 10 miles North West of Worcester.

Practice starts at
9:30 am on both days and the event starts after a lunch break at 2.30 pm

Excellent catering and light refreshment/bar facilities are available in the new Stratstone restaurant in the paddock and elsewhere on the hill.

There are two shops selling a range of souvenirs, books, gifts and clothing.
